WESTERN SYDNEY WANDERERS INS: Antony Golec (From ACL contract to HAL contract), Dean Bouzanis (Carlisle United), Vitor Saba (Brescia), Brendan Hamill (Seongnam), Romeo Castelen (RKC Wallwijk), Seyi Adeleke (Lazio) OUTS: Adam D’Apuzzo (Retired), Michael Beauchamp (PTT Rayong), Jerome Polenz (Sarpsborg), Aaron Mooy (Melbourne City), Tahj Minniecon (Rockdale City Sun), Josh Barresi (Newcastle Jets), Youssouf Hersi (Perth Glory), Jerrad Tyson (Sun Pegasus), Shinji Ono (Consadole Sapporo), Dean Heffernan (Bulli) PRE-SEASON RESULTS (excluding ACL): P 6 W 4 L 2 Defeated Macarthur Rams 1-0; Canberra FC 1-0; APIA Leichhardt 1-0 and Al Jazira 2-1. Lost to East Riffa 2-1. FFA CUP: lost to Adelaide City 1-0. LAST YEAR: so close, yet so far again. But while Western Sydney didn’t produce a miracle winning streak again, they proved that there would be no such thing as second year syndrome at Wanderland. THIS YEAR: Popovic has put the broomstick through the squad that he built – and if not for the evidence of this current ACL run, some may wonder how the Wanderers will go. But with his ability to extract the most out of his players and his impressive transfer track record so far, things bode well for another concerted push from the club in their third season. Shinji Ono is tough to replace but there were glimpses of genuine gold from Saba in Seoul on Wednesday, while Romeo Castelen a vastly experienced Dutchman with international and Eredivise experience, comes in for Hersi. TRADING GRADE: par. So far, it’s been Popovic’s way or the highway. It’s worked, so it should be fascinating if this overhaul after two years, with faith also being shown in the club’s up-and-coming youngsters, suitably revitalises the squad.
